1

アプリの実行時に 1 つ以上のジョブ/トリガーを設定できるようにしたいと考えています。ジョブとトリガーのリストは、db テーブルから取得されます。再起動や追跡の目的でジョブをデータベースに永続化することは気にしません。基本的には、DB テーブルを INIt デバイスとして使用したいだけです。明らかに、私は自分でコードを書くことでこれを行うことができますが、スケジューラを使用してアプリの存続期間全体にわたってデータベースを更新し続けるオーバーヘッドなしで、SQLJobStore を使用してこの機能を取得する方法があるかどうか疑問に思っています。

助けてくれてありがとう!エリック

4

1 に答える 1

0

ジョブ ストアの主な目的は、スケジューラの状態を格納することです。そのため、必要なことを行う方法は組み込まれていません。必要に応じて、いつでもテーブルに直接書き込むことができます。これにより、必要な結果が得られますが、これは実際には最善の方法ではありません。

これを行うための推奨される方法は、テーブルからデータを読み取り、リモーティングを使用してスケジューラに接続してジョブをスケジュールするコードを作成することです。

于 2012-07-05T18:18:59.250 に答える